Deck Board Replacement in Redmond, WA
Deck board replacement services involve removing damaged, rotting, or worn-out boards and installing new ones to restore the safety and appearance of a deck. This service typically covers projects where individual boards are cracked, splintered, or compromised by weather or age, helping property owners maintain a sturdy outdoor space. Homeowners often request this service when they notice loose or broken boards, or when planning to refresh the look of their deck without replacing the entire structure.
Before requesting deck board replacement, property owners usually want to understand the types of materials available, such as composite, wood, or alternative options, and how they will match existing decking. It’s also helpful to consider the scope of the work, including whether only specific boards need replacement or if additional repairs are necessary. Clarifying these details can ensure the project aligns with the desired outcome for safety, durability, and visual appeal.

Deck Board Replacement Questions
What are deck boards? Deck boards are the flat planks that form the surface of a deck, providing a stable walking area.
When should deck boards be replaced? Replacement is recommended when boards are rotting, cracked, or loose, affecting safety and appearance.
What types of materials are used for deck board replacement? Common materials include pressure-treated wood, composite, and PVC decking options.
Can damaged deck boards be repaired instead of replaced? Minor damage may be repaired, but severely rotted or broken boards typically require full replacement for safety.
